Sarto, HolyFamily. 82 Van Dyck, Portrait ofCard. Bentivoglio. Sala di Apollo. 58 A. delSarto, Deposition. 63 Murillo,Virgin and Child. 40 Raphael,Leo x. 67 Titian, Magdalen. Sala di Venere. 15 and 4Salvator Rosa, Marine pictures.1 and 20 Albert Diirer (copies), Eveand Adam. 437 Van Dyck, Flightinto Egypt. 272 A. del Sarto, Johnthe Baptist. 14 Rubens, Returnfrom Hay - making. 9 Rubens,Ulysses and Nausicaa, with finelandscape. 79 Raphael, Julius n.The head only is by Raphael. 92Titian, so-called Duke of Norfolk. We now return to the Sala diGiove, and pass through the dooron the right into The Stanza di Prometeo. Onthe wall on the left, 343 FilippoLippi, Virgin and Child, with theMeeting of Joachim and Anna, andthe Nativity of Mary in the back-ground. 140 Bugiardini (attri-buted to Leonardo), so - calledMonaca. On the right of theentrance : 365 Albertinelli, HolyFamily. 353 and 348 are not worksof Botticelli: neither is 380 byGiorgione, nor 382 by Sodoma, nor371 by Piero della Francesca.

N M * n 96 Florence—The Boboli Gardens GUIDE TO ITALY On the right is the Galleria delPoccetti, containing a magnificentmalachite table, and a bust ofNapoleon by Canova. We pass bya corridor into the Sala dellaGiustizia. 408 Peter Lely, Por-trait of Oliver Cromwell. 409Sebastiano del Piombo, Portrait.54 Titian, Pietro Aretino. 3 Tin-toretto, Venus, Cupid, and Vulcan. Stanza di Flora. In the centreis the Bather of Canova. 416, 421,436, 441 Poussin, Landscapes. 429Ruysdael, Landscape. Stanza dei Putti. 453 SalvadorRosa, Peace burning the Weaponsof War, with Landscape. We now return to the Stanza diPrometeo and pass through a dooron the rt. into the Stanza diUlisse. 307 A. del Sarto, Virginand Child with six saints. Passing by the Stanza delBagno, we enter the Stanza dellEducazione di Giove. 270 GuidoReni, Cleopatra. 266 C. Bold, St.Andrew. 256 Fra Rartolommeo,Holy Family. 96 Grist.
